So we have the equation:


B=d\pi r^2

And we want to solve for r.

So first, isolate the r variable. Divide both sides by dπ. So:


(B)/(d\pi)=(d\pi r^2)/(d\pi)

The right side cancels:


(B)/(d\pi)=r^2

Take the square root of both sides:


r=\sqrt(B)/(d\pi)

We can rearrange the terms:


r=\sqrt(B)/(\pi d)
